Pray for Friends

I thank my God in all my remembrance of you, always in every prayer of mine for you all making my prayer with joy.

─ Philippians 1:3-4


Ralph Waldo Emerson said, “The glory of friendship is not the outstretched hand, nor the kindly smile, nor the joy of companionship; it is the spiritual inspiration that comes to one when he discovers that someone else believes in him and is willing to trust him.”

We all have people in our lives who pour into us in some way or another. Different friends meet different needs: emotional support, trusted advice, a guaranteed good time when we get together with this one or that one.

Each one is a gift. They meet a need, fill a void or make our lives more complete. Unfortunately, most of us don’t thank God enough for the gift they are. It’s also important to sit down and share with each individual just how much they mean to us and how they specifically fit so well with us.

Besides expressing our gratitude to them, another way to show affection is to pray for them. No matter how wonderful life seems, we all have challenges – or will have them – and covering our friends in prayer is a way to give back.


Today’s One Thing

Take time this week to thank God for those who bring joy into your life. Write a note to two people this week and tell them what they mean to you.
